In 1997 I set up a multimedia company, FUSE101, along with two partners. During the time I worked with them, we built up an extensive client base including HSBC Offshore and Guernsey Telecoms. In many cases we orchestrated our customers' very first online presence, as well as working on and pioneering a wider range of, what was then, New Media projects including the first networked webcams on beaches for a website we set up, called Beachheads, and the first 24hr streamed webcast from Ibiza, which we set up in Café Mambo.
We sold the company in 2002.
